<?xml version="1.0" encoding="utf-8"?>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="bg" lang="bg">
<head>
<title>CSS Валидатор Ръководството за Използване</title>
<link rev="made" href="mailto:www-validator-css@w3.org" />
<link rev="start" href="./" title="Home Page" />
<style type="text/css" media="all">
@import "style/base.css";
@import "style/docs.css";
</style>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<meta name="revision"
content="$Id: manual.html.bg,v 1.3 2010/01/14 14:10:29 ylafon Exp $" />
<!-- SSI Template Version: $Id: manual.html.bg,v 1.3 2010/01/14 14:10:29 ylafon Exp $ -->
</head>
<body>
<div id="banner">
<h1 id="title"><a href="http://www.w3.org/"><img alt="W3C" width="110" height="61" id="logo" src="./images/w3c.png" /></a>
<a href="./"><span>CSS Validation Service</span></a></h1>
<p id="tagline">
Проверете Cascading Style Sheets (CSS) и (X)HTML документи със style sheets
</p>
</div>
<div id="main">
<!-- This DIV encapsulates everything in this page - necessary for the positioning -->
<div class="doc">
<h2>CSS Валидатор Ръководство на Потребителя</h2>
<h3 id="TableOfContents">Съдържание</h3>
<div id="toc">
<ul>
<li><a href="#use">Как се използва CSS Валидатора</a>
<ul>
<li><a href="#url">Валидиране по URL отговор</a></li>
<li><a href="#fileupload">Валидиране чрез изпращане на файл</a></li>
<li><a href="#directinput">Валидиране чрез директно въвеждане</a></li>
<li><a href="#basicvalidation">Какво прави основната валидация?</a></li>
</ul>
</li>
<li><a href="#advanced">Разширено валидиране</a>
<ul>
<li><a href="#paramwarnings">Параметър предупреждение</a></li>
<li><a href="#paramprofile">Параметър профил</a></li>
<li><a href="#parammedium">Параметър медия</a></li>
</ul>
</li>
<li><a href="#expert">За експерти</a>
<ul>
<li><a href="#requestformat">Формат на Заявката за Валидация</a></li>
<li><a href="#api">Web Service API на CSS Валидатора</a></li>
</ul>
</li>
</ul>
</div>
<p id="skip"></p>
<h3 id="use">Как се използва CSS Валидатора</h3>
<p>
Най-лесния начин за проверка на документ е чрез използване на основния интерфейс.
На тази страница ще намерите три форми съответстващи на три възможности:
</p>
<h4 id="url">Валидиране по URL</h4>
<p>
Просто въвеждате URL на документа, който желаете да валидирате.
Документа може да бъде HTML или CSS.
</p>
<img style="display: block; margin-left:auto; margin-right: auto;"
src="./images/uri_basic.png" alt="Валидация по URI" />
<h4 id="fileupload">Валидиране чрез изпращане на файл</h4>
<p>
Това решение Ви позволява да изпратите за проверка локален файл.
Натиснете бутона "Browse..." и изберете файла, който желате да проверите.
</p>
<img style="display: block; margin-left:auto; margin-right: auto;"
src="./images/file_upload_basic.png"
alt="Валидация чрез Изпращане на Файл" />
<p>
В този случай са разрешени само CSS документи. Това означава,
че не можете да изпратите (X)HTML документ. Трябва да сте внимателни също
с @import правилата, тъй като те ще бъдат последвани единствено ако сочат
към публичен URL (така, че забравете за относителните пътища в този случай).
</p>
<h4 id="directinput">Валидиране чрез директно въвеждане</h4>
<p>
This method is perfect for testing CSS fragments. You just have to
write your CSS in the textarea
</p>
<img style="display: block; margin-left:auto; margin-right: auto;"
src="./images/direct_input_basic.png"
alt="Валидация чрез директно въвеждане" />
<p>
Важат същите коментари както преди малко. Забележете, че това решение е
особено подходящо ако имате проблеми и се нуждаете от помощ от общността.
То е също много полезен при съобщаване за бъг, защото можете да направите
връзка към страницата с резултата и да я добавите като тестов случай.
</p>
<h4 id="basicvalidation">Какво прави основната валидация?</h4>
<p>
Когато се използва основния интерфейс, валидаторът ще провери за съвместимост
с <a href="http://www.w3.org/TR/CSS2">CSS 2</a>, който е настоящата CSS
Техническа Препоръка.<br />
Ще произведе XHTML резултат без никакви предупреждения (ще се бъдат изведени
само грешки).<br />
Медия е зададена на "Всички", което означава медия, подходяща за всички
устройства (виж <a href="http://www.w3.org/TR/CSS2/media.html">
http://www.w3.org/TR/CSS2/media.html</a> за пълно описание на медия).
</p>
<h3 id="advanced">Разширено валидиране</h3>
<p>
Ако се инате нужда от по-специфична проверка, може да използвате разширения интерфейс,
който позволява да се определят три параметъра. Следва и кратка помощ за всеки един от
тези параметри.
</p>
<h4 id="paramwarnings">Предупреждения</h4>
<p>
Този параметър е полезен за настройка на текстовете на CSS Валидатора.
Всъщност, валидатора може да дава два типа съобщения: грешки и предупреждения.
Грешки се връщат, когато проверения CSS не спазва CSS препоръка. Предупрежденията
са различават от грешките, защото те не се базират на проблем със спецификацията.
Те са предназначени да уведомяват (!) CSS разработчика, че някои положения
може да са опасни и може да доведат до странно поведение при някои потребителски агенти.
</p>
<p>
Типично предупреждение се отнася до font-family: ако не е определен род шрифт (generic font),
ще получите предупреждение гласящо, че трябва да добавите такъв в края на правилото,
иначе потребителски агент, които не познава нито един от други шрифтове ще
премине към използване на шрифт по подразбиране, което може да доведе до непредвидени
резултати в изобразяването на документа.
</p>
<h4 id="paramprofile">Профил</h4>
<p>
CSS валидатора може да проверява различни CSS профили. Профилът съдържа всички
особености, които една имплементация на отделна платформа се очаква да има.
Тази дефиниция е посочена в
<a href="http://www.w3.org/Style/2004/css-charter-long.html#modules-and-profiles0">
сайта на CSS</a>. Изборът по подразбиране съответства на настоящия най-използван:
<a href="http://www.w3.org/TR/CSS2">CSS 2</a>.
</p>
<h4 id="parammedium">Медия</h4>
<p>
Медия параметърът е еквивалентен на @media правилото, прилагано към
целия документ. Повече информация за медия ще намерите в
<a href="http://www.w3.org/TR/CSS2/media.html">
http://www.w3.org/TR/CSS2/media.html
</a>.
</p>
<h3 id="expert">Само за Експерти</h3>
<h4 id="requestformat">Формат на Заявката за Валидация</h4>
<p>Долу има таблица на параметрите, които може да се използват при
изпращане на заявка към W3C CSS Валидатора.</p>
<p>Ако желаете да използвате публичния валидираща услуга на W3C, използвайте
параметрите долу заедно със следния базов URI:<br />
<kbd>http://jigsaw.w3.org/css-validator/validator</kbd><br />
заменете с адреса на вашия собствен сървър ако желаете да се обърнете към
частна инстанция на валидатора.</p>
<p><strong>Бележка</strong>: Ако желаете да се обърнете към валидатора програматично
за пакет от документи, моля, убедете се, че скрипта ви ще изчаква
(<code>sleep</code>) <strong>най-малко 1 секунда</strong> между заявките.
CSS Валидатора е безплатна публична услуга, ще сме признателни
за вниманието ви. Благодаря.</p>
<table class="refdoc">
<tbody>
<tr>
<th>Параметър</th>
<th>Описание</th>
<th>Стойност по подразбиране</th>
</tr>
<tr>
<th>uri</th>
<td><acronym title="Universal Resource Locator">URL</acronym> на
документа за валидиране. CSS и HTML документи са позволени.</td>
<td>Няма, но или този параметър или <code>text</code> трябва да се
предаде.</td>
</tr>
<tr>
<th>text</th>
<td>Документа за валидиране, само CSS е позволен.</td>
<td>Няма, но или този параметър или <code>url</code> трябва да се
предаде.</td>
</tr>
<tr>
<th>usermedium</th>
<td><a href="http://www.w3.org/TR/CSS2/media.html">Медия</a>
използвана за валидиране, като <code>screen</code>,
<code>print</code>, <code>braille</code>...</td>
<td><code>all</code></td>
</tr>
<tr>
<th>output</th>
<td>Активира различните формати за резултат на валидтора. Възможните
формати са
<code>text/html</code> и <code>html</code> (XHTML документ,
Content-Type: text/html),
<code>application/xhtml+xml</code> и <code>xhtml</code> (XHTML
документ, Content-Type: application/xhtml+xml),
<code>application/soap+xml</code> и <code>soap12</code> (SOAP 1.2
документ, Content-Type: application/soap+xml),
<code>text/plain</code> и <code>text</code> (текстов документ,
Content-Type: text/plain),
eвсичко останало (XHTML документ, Content-Type: text/html)
</td>
<td>html</td>
</tr>
<tr>
<th>profile</th>
<td>CSS профил използван за валидиране. Може да бъде
<code>css1</code>, <code>css2</code>, <code>css21</code>,
<code>css3</code>, <code>svg</code>, <code>svgbasic</code>,
<code>svgtiny</code>, <code>mobile</code>, <code>atsc-tv</code>,
<code>tv</code> или <code>none</code></td>
<td>последнаста W3C
Препоръка: CSS 2</td>
</tr>
<tr>
<th>lang</th>
<td>Езикът изпозлван за отговор, към момента, <code>en</code>,
<code>fr</code>, <code>ja</code>, <code>es</code>,
<code>zh-cn</code>, <code>nl</code>, <code>de</code>, <code>it</code>,
<code>pl</code>.</td>
<td>Английски (<code>en</code>).</td>
</tr>
<tr>
<th>warning</th>
<td>Нивото на предупреждения, <code>no</code> няма предупреждения, <code>0</code>
за някои предупреждения, <code>1</code> или <code>2</code> за повече предупреждения
</td>
<td>2</td>
</tr>
</tbody>
</table>
<h4 id="api">Web Service API на CSS Валидатора: документация на SOAP 1.2 валидиращ интерфейс</h4>
<p>
За допълнителна техническа помощ и в частност SOAP 1.2 резултата и
възможните начини за заявка към валидатора, вижте
<a href="./api.html">Web Service API на CSS Валидатора</a>.
</p>
</div>
</div>
<!-- End of "main" DIV. -->
<ul class="navbar" id="menu">
<li><strong><a href="./" title="Начална страница на W3C CSS Validation Service">Начало</a></strong> <span class="hideme">|</span></li>
<li><a href="about.html" title="За услугата">За W3C Валидатор</a> <span class="hideme">|</span></li>
<li><a href="documentation.html" title="Документация за W3C CSS Validation Service">Документация</a> <span class="hideme">|</span></li>
<li><a href="DOWNLOAD.html" title="Изтегляне на CSS валидатор">Изтегляне</a> <span class="hideme">|</span></li>
<li><a href="Email.html" title="Как да изкажем мнение за тази услуга">Обратна връзка</a> <span class="hideme">|</span></li>
<li><a href="thanks.html" title="Благодарност и признание">Благодарност</a><span class="hideme">|</span></li>
</ul>
<ul id="lang_choice">
<li><a href="manual.html.bg"
lang="bg"
xml:lang="bg"
hreflang="bg"
rel="alternate">Български</a></li>
<li><a href="manual.html.de"
lang="de"
xml:lang="de"
hreflang="de"
rel="alternate">Deutsch</a></li>
<li><a href="manual.html.en"
lang="en"
xml:lang="en"
hreflang="en"
rel="alternate">English</a> </li>
<li><a href="manual.html.es"
lang="es" xml:lang="es" hreflang="es"
rel="alternate">Español</a></li>
<li><a href="manual.html.fr"
lang="fr"
xml:lang="fr"
hreflang="fr"
rel="alternate">Français</a> </li>
<li><a href="manual.html.it"
lang="it"
xml:lang="it"
hreflang="it"
rel="alternate">Italiano</a> </li>
<li><a href="manual.html.nl"
lang="nl"
xml:lang="nl"
hreflang="nl"
rel="alternate">Nederlands</a> </li>
<li><a href="manual.html.ja"
lang="ja"
xml:lang="ja"
hreflang="ja"
rel="alternate">日本語</a> </li>
<li><a href="manual.html.pl-PL"
lang="pl"
xml:lang="pl"
hreflang="pl"
rel="alternate">Polski</a> </li>
<li><a href="manual.html.zh-cn"
lang="zh-hans"
xml:lang="zh-hans"
hreflang="zh-hans"
rel="alternate">中文</a></li>
</ul>
<div id="footer">
<p id="activity_logos">
<a href="http://www.w3.org/QA/" title="W3C's Quality Assurance Activity, Ви предлага безплатни инструменти за качество в Мрежата и други"><img src="http://www.w3.org/QA/2002/12/qa-small.png" alt="QA" /></a><a href="http://dichev.com/Style/CSS/learning/" title="Научете повече за Cascading Style Sheets"><img src="images/woolly-icon" alt="CSS" /></a>
</p>
<p id="support_logo">
Подкрепете този инструмент, станете<br />
<a href="http://www.w3.org/Consortium/supporters"><img src="http://www.w3.org/Consortium/supporter-logos/csupporter.png" alt="W3C Поддръжник" /></a>
</p>
<p class="copyright">
<a rel="Copyright" href="http://www.w3.org/Consortium/Legal/ipr-notice#Copyright">Copyright</a> © 1994-2007
<a href="http://www.w3.org/"><acronym title="World Wide Web Consortium">W3C</acronym></a>®
(<a href="http://www.csail.mit.edu/"><acronym title="Massachusetts Institute of Technology">MIT</acronym></a>,
<a href="http://www.ercim.eu/"><acronym title="European Research Consortium for Informatics and Mathematics">ERCIM</acronym></a>,
<a href="http://www.keio.ac.jp/">Keio</a>),
All Rights Reserved.
W3C <a href="http://www.w3.org/Consortium/Legal/ipr-notice#Legal_Disclaimer">liability</a>,
<a href="http://www.w3.org/Consortium/Legal/ipr-notice#W3C_Trademarks">trademark</a>,
<a rel="Copyright" href="http://www.w3.org/Consortium/Legal/copyright-documents">document use</a>
and <a rel="Copyright" href="http://www.w3.org/Consortium/Legal/copyright-software">software licensing</a>
rules apply. Your interactions with this site are in accordance
with our <a href="http://www.w3.org/Consortium/Legal/privacy-statement#Public">public</a> and
<a href="http://www.w3.org/Consortium/Legal/privacy-statement#Members">Member</a> privacy
statements.
</p>
</div>
</body>
</html>
Webmaster